Description

The 330980-71-05 is a high-performance 3300 XL NSv Proximitor Sensor engineered by Bently Nevada for specialized eddy-current machinery protection systems. This proximity sensor is purposefully optimized for demanding industrial deployment areas featuring compact installation constraints, such as centrifugal air compressors, process gas machinery, and refrigeration compression skids. It operates as a critical signal conditioner, converting raw electromagnetic gaps into a linear voltage signal to track machine health parameters.

The specific variant 330980-71-05 is designated for a 7.0-meter (23.0 feet) total system loop length and is equipped with an integrated DIN-rail mounting track pad. It includes Multiple Agency Approvals for universal hazardous area safety installation compliance. Featuring robust RFI/EMI shielding and specialized SpringLoc terminal blocks, this thin-profile aluminum sensor provides high-stability signal fidelity and effortless field wire terminations without the need for specialized routing tools.

Technical Specifications

Parameter Detail
Manufacturer Bently Nevada (Baker Hughes) 
Part Number 330980-71-05 
Transducer System Series 3300 XL NSv Proximity Transducer System 
Total System Length 7.0 meters (23.0 feet) 
Mounting Hardware Configuration Integrated DIN-rail mount backing pad 
Agency Approval Rating 05 = Multiple Approvals (North America, ATEX/Europe, IECEx, Brazil) 
Average Scale Factor (ASF) 7.87 V/mm (200 mV/mil) typical when calibrated to AISI 4140 steel 
Linear Measurement Range 1.5 mm (60 mils), beginning at approx 0.25 mm (10 mils) from target 
Input Signal Compatibility Accepts one non-contacting 3300 NSv or 3300 RAM probe and cable loop 
Supply Voltage Window -17.5 Vdc to -26 Vdc (Unbarrier-assisted maximum consumption 12 mA) 
Output Impedance Value 50 ohm 
Frequency Response Boundaries 0 to 10 kHz: +0, -3 dB typical (with up to 305m field wiring) 
Field Wiring Target Terminal Size 0.2 to 1.5 mm squares (16 to 24 AWG) solid or stranded 
Enclosure Structural Material A380 die-cast aluminum 
Sensor Component Net Weight 255 grams (9 ounces) typical 
Operating Temperature Envelope -35 degC to +85 degC (-31 degF to +185 degF) 
Storage Temperature Envelope -51 degC to +105 degC (-60 degF to +221 degF) 
Relative Humidity Resistance 100% condensing, non-submersible with protected ClickLoc connections

Installation Guidelines

  • DIN Rail Attachment: Snap the Proximitor Sensor base pad securely onto standard 35mm DIN rail tracks. Ensure the underlying replacement mounting pad isolates the metal chassis frame from raw cabinet ground grids to eliminate loops.
  • Matched Loop Length Balance: Verify that the combined mechanical lengths of the attached 3300 NSv probe and extension cable sum to exactly 7.0 meters to maintain calibrated scale factors.
  • Field Wire Termination: Use recommended three-conductor shielded triad cable (16 to 24 AWG). Depress the SpringLoc cage clips to seat bare wire ends completely before releasing tension.
  • Connector Weatherproofing: Install specialized male/female connector protectors or apply a wrap of self-fusing silicone tape over the coaxial links to block process fluids and maintain 100% condensing humidity defenses.

Can the 330980-71-05 Proximitor Sensor be mounted directly to a bare metal panel without a pad?

No. The sensor must be used with its dedicated mounting pad to ensure it is properly isolated from the housing or cabinet ground, which prevents ground loops from disrupting the low-voltage vibration readings.

What is the meaning of the '-05' suffix code in this part number?

The '-05' suffix specifies the Agency Approval Option, indicating that the Proximitor Sensor is certified with Multiple Approvals for dangerous and hazardous environments across North America, Europe, and international regions.

Can I pair this 7.0-meter sensor with a 5.0-meter probe and cable combination?

No. The total combined length of the proximity probe and extension cable must match the 7.0-meter design configuration of the sensor exactly, otherwise the scale factor will deviate and create severe calibration errors.
